Russia's powerful Prime Minister Vladimir Putin will visit India in March next year at the invitation of Prime Minister Manmohan Singh.

"I am very grateful to you for accepting my invitation in March next year. I am confident that your visit would give anew fillip to our ties," Singh said a meeting with Putin in Moscow on Monday.

Singh, who is on a three-day tour to Russia, reminded that it was the then President Putin's maiden India visit to India in 2000 during which the declaration of Indo-Russian strategic partnership was signed.

"That was a historic visit, which laid the foundation of our relations," Singh said at the start of his parleys with Putin.

The two leaders will also address the Indo-Russian CEOs Council co-chaired by Mukesh Ambani of RIL and Vladimir Evtushenkov of 'Sistema' conglomerate, which markets mobile services in India under MTS brand.
